Observability Fundamentals
Observability
Observability is the ability to understand a system's internal state from the telemetry it emits — logs, metrics, and traces — so you can debug problems you didn't predict.

Telemetry is data emitted by software systems about their own behavior — logs, metrics, traces, and events — collected remotely to monitor, debug, and optimize those systems.

A telemetry pipeline (or observability pipeline) collects, transforms, filters, enriches, and routes logs, metrics, and traces between sources and destinations — controlling cost and data quality in flight.

Four Golden Signals
The four golden signals — latency, traffic, errors, and saturation — are Google SRE's recommended minimum set of metrics for monitoring any user-facing system.

High cardinality means a field or metric label has a very large number of unique values — user IDs, container IDs, request IDs — which can explode storage and query costs in many observability systems.

Distributed tracing tracks a single request as it travels through the services of a distributed system, recording timing and context at every hop so you can pinpoint where latency and errors originate.

A span is the basic unit of a distributed trace — one named, timed operation with attributes, events, and a parent — and a trace is the tree of spans a single request produces.

DORA Metrics
DORA metrics are four research-backed measures of software delivery performance — deployment frequency, lead time for changes, change failure rate, and failed deployment recovery time.

An error budget is the amount of unreliability an SLO permits — if your target is 99.9%, the 0.1% is budget you can spend on releases, experiments, and maintenance before halting risk.

MTTD (mean time to detect) measures how quickly you notice an incident; MTTR (mean time to resolve) measures how quickly you fix it. Together they define how long users feel your failures.

An SLI is what you measure (e.g., percent of successful requests), an SLO is the internal target you set for it (99.9%), and an SLA is the external contract with consequences if you miss it.
